It is seen that there is no dispute about leviability of service tax under franchise service with effect from 16.6.2005 and that amount has already been paid along with interest and duly appropriated. Indeed we find that while imposing penalty under Section 78 ibid only the amount of service tax leviable for the period prior to 16.6.2005 has been taken into account and no penalty was levied in relation to the amount of service tax leviable with effect from on 16.6.2005. As is evident from the forgoing the only issue involved in this case is whether condition No. iv of the definition of franchise given in Section 65(47) of Finance Act, 1994 was satisfied in terms of the franchise agreement entered into by the appellant.
